THE ART OF SALLI SACHSE

Former 60s beach party regular Salli Sachse is now an extremely talented artist living back in her native San Diego.  Some of her work is on display in the recently opened exhibition “High Tides & Summer Nights” at the La Jolla Association of Art.  See the below link for more information and enjoy the trailer for The Trip starring Peter Fonda and Salli in her most notorious role as the LSD Freak Out Girl.

PETULIA

Though she is a quissential ’60s girl, I was never much of a fan of Julie Christie, probably because she became too big a movie star.  TCM is hosting a marathon of her movies today beginning with The Go-Between today at 11:30mAM EST.  Among her films being aired are Doctor Zhivago, Darling featuring her Academy Award winning perfrmance, and Shampoo.  See link to full schedule below. But the film I am interested in seeing is the mod Petulia (1968) set in San Francisco during the height of the free love generation, Christie plays a socialite, married to abusive Richard Chamberlain (looking quite hot with his sruffy hair), who falls for doctor George C. Scott who is in the process of divorcing Shirley Knight. See the trailer.

A COOL BLONDE

Though she is more of a 50’s star, if it wasn’t for Kim Novak (and Carroll Baker) we wouldn’t have the 60’s baby doll blonds Tuesday Weld, Carol Lynley, Yvette Mimieux, Diane McBain, Sue Lyon that we love so much.

The Egyptian Theater in LA is honoring Novak with a 3 day film festival in lieu of the soon-to-be-released DVD box set of her movies including the melodramatic trash fest Jeanne Eagles with Novak playing that drunken mess of an actress from the 20’s. See trailer below.
